Fleece is a fantastic material that is becoming increasingly popular in clothing production. But what exactly is it? Fleece, essentially, is a 100% synthetic non-woven fabric made from polyester and other artificial materials. The name "fleece" comes from English and means "wool," but don't be misled by this impression – fleece is synthetic, capable of warming but not at all similar to natural wool. Typically, secondary raw materials such as plastic bottles and film are used for the production of fleece fabric. This eco-concept allows for the creation of warm and pleasant-to-touch clothing while combating pollution of the planet.

The main characteristics of fleece make it an indispensable choice for many:
- **Lightweight**: Fleece fabric is very light, making it an excellent choice for children and those who value comfort.
- **Elasticity**: The material stretches well, does not restrict movements, and retains its shape, so clothing made of fleece does not deform.
- **Durability**: With proper care, fleece clothing lasts very long, maintaining its properties and keeping an attractive appearance.
- **Low Maintenance**: Items made from this fabric do not require ironing; they can be folded without fearing creases.
- **Breathability**: Fleece is a breathable material that excellently allows air through, preventing overheating, but it can easily be blown through in windy weather, so it's better to wear it under a membrane garment.
- **Moisture Resistant**, dries quickly, and warms even when damp.
- **Hypoallergenic**: The synthetic material does not cause allergic reactions and is suitable for children's clothing.
- **Antibacterial**: Fleece does not promote the growth of bacteria, dust mites, moths, and mold.
- **High Thermal Insulation** and affordable price thanks to cheap raw materials and the absence of a patent for fleece fabric.
- **Flammability**: It's best to avoid contact with open flame as it easily ignites.

In turn, fleece can vary in thickness and density, which determines its application:
- **Microfleece** has the lowest density (100 g/m²) and is used for children's clothing and underwear.
- **Medium-density fleece** (200 g/m²) is the most common and used for sweaters, hoodies, pants, sportswear, and home textiles.
- **Thick fleece** (300 g/m²) is suitable for winter clothing and blankets.
- **Extra-thick fleece** (from 400 g/m²) is designed for extreme temperatures and used in outdoor and sports clothing and gear.

Regarding the comparison of fleece with natural wool, studies have shown that both materials retain heat equally, both in dry and wet conditions. However, fleece items dry faster, therefore, warm up quicker, which can be an important factor when choosing clothing for active recreation or tourism, especially if the journey lasts several days. Also, remember that fleece clothing should not be dried over an open flame.

In any case, it's important to understand that fleece is just a middle insulating layer, so for maximum comfort, it can be combined with other materials, such as wool thermal underwear.

Regarding the care of fleece, it's important to follow certain rules: wash at a temperature of 30-40 degrees on a "delicate" mode, without using bleach and fabric softeners. It's not recommended to wring out fleece, but to dry it unfolded at room temperature.
